🔍 What Does the Three-Dot Tattoo Actually Mean?

The three-dot tattoo, which is usually arranged in the shape of a triangle but sometimes in a straight line, carries a multitude of meanings. It spans across different cultures, histories, and personal philosophies. Here are the five most common interpretations today:

1. Mi Vida Loca (“My Crazy Life”)

This is arguably the most common historical interpretation of the three dots. It is deeply rooted in a lifestyle of risk, resilience, and survival.

  • The Context: This meaning originated heavily within Chicano and Mexican-American culture. It served as a shorthand for a life that has been exceptionally challenging, unpredictable, and lived on the edge.
  • The Real Meaning: Despite what alarmist articles suggest, this is generally not a threat to the public. It is simply a statement of where someone has come from, the hardships they have faced, and their resilience in surviving a “crazy life.”

2. “Three” as a Universal Number

Sometimes, the meaning is incredibly straightforward: it is a simple representation of the number three. However, the number three holds massive significance across human history.

  • The Meaning: Three can represent the fundamental pillars of human existence: the past, the present, and the future. It can signify the beginning, middle, and end of a journey. For others, it stands for the core of their social circle: family, friendship, and love.

3. Religious and Spiritual Meanings

Geometric shapes have been used in spiritual practices for thousands of years. The triangle, formed by three points, is one of the most ancient symbols known to humanity.

  • The Meaning: In Christianity, three dots can represent the Holy Trinity (the Father, the Son, and the Holy Spirit). In various other spiritual practices, the triad represents the essential balance of the mind, body, and spirit. It is a deeply personal symbol meant to ground the wearer.

4. Personal or Sentimental Meaning

Tattoos are often emotional anchors. Many people get a three-dot tattoo to permanently commemorate three specific entities in their lives.

  • The Meaning: Highly personal and sentimental. It could represent three siblings, three children, three major life events that changed their trajectory, or three core values they refuse to compromise on.

5. The Minimalist Aesthetic

We cannot ignore modern tattoo culture. Fine-line, minimalist tattoos have surged in popularity over the last decade.

  • The Meaning: Sometimes, a cigar is just a cigar, and a tattoo is just a design choice. Many people simply love the clean, balanced, and mysterious look of three delicate dots. It requires no profound explanation other than, “I thought it looked cool.”

Why the “Run Away” Headline Is Wildly Misleading

Let’s address the elephant in the room. The “run as far as you can” headline is specifically engineered by content farms to create fear and generate clicks. It implies that a three-dot tattoo is an immediate, universal red flag for danger. The reality is quite the opposite: the vast majority of three-dot tattoos are entirely harmless.

The Gang Association: To be completely fair and factual, in certain very specific contexts (such as within the prison system or specific street environments), a three-dot tattoo on the hand or near the eye can be associated with gang membership. However, this is not the standard rule for everyday society.

The Caution: Context is everything. If you see a three-dot tattoo on someone’s hand, sure, it could be a gang sign from their past. But it is just as likely to be a personal symbol of their faith, their family, or their personal growth.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Is a three-dot tattoo always a gang sign?
No, absolutely not. While it can be in very specific environments, it is not a universal gang symbol. Context, placement, and the individual matter immensely.

Should I be afraid if I see someone with a three-dot tattoo?
No. Most people wearing three-dot tattoos are everyday individuals with personal, spiritual, or aesthetic reasons for their ink. There is no need for panic.

What does the phrase “Mi Vida Loca” actually mean?
It translates from Spanish to “My crazy life.” It’s a cultural phrase acknowledging the chaos, struggles, and ultimate survival of a difficult life.

Can a three-dot tattoo be a religious symbol?
Yes! Many people use it to symbolize the Holy Trinity in Christianity or the mind-body-spirit connection in various spiritual practices.
